About Copper Roofing

Copper roofing is the pinnacle of architectural metalwork. A copper roof develops a natural chemistry with the atmosphere — starting bright rose-copper, aging through russet brown, and eventually settling into the iconic verdigris green patina that defines historic capitals, cathedrals, and the finest estates. ADC Roofing shop-fabricates standing seam copper roofs, flat-lock copper wall and roof panels, and one-off architectural details: bay window caps, dormer roofs, cupolas, finials, decorative valleys, chimney crickets, and copper gutter/downspout systems. We source 16, 20, and 24 oz. cold-rolled copper (and lead-coated copper where salt exposure demands it) from Revere Copper, Aurubis, and Hussey Copper.

Manufacturers We Install

Revere Copper Products

America's oldest continuously operating manufacturer. Architectural cold-rolled copper coil and sheet since 1801.

Aurubis (formerly Nordic Copper)

European architectural copper: Nordic Standard, Nordic Brown pre-oxidized, and Nordic Green pre-patinated.

Hussey Copper

Domestic copper coil and sheet — soft, half-hard, and hard temper for standing seam and flat-lock.

Copper Sales Inc. — UNA-CLAD™

Copper standing seam and flat-lock roof/wall panel systems with engineered clip systems.
